Update Your Existing Router Firmware

As a matter of fact, your existing WiFi router firmware just needs to be updated by the latest version of technology.

Mostly, all router manufacturers are always tweaking (pull or twist) software to eke (increase or save) out a small amount of speed.

How hard—or how easy—it is to upgrade your existing router's firmware depends upon the device make and model entirely.

Nowadays, most routers have an update process built into the administration interface right-away. So, folks, it is just a matter of clicking on the 'firmware upgrade' button.

Routers of other models, particularly if they're of an older version, requires you to visit the manufacturer's website - download an up-to-date firmware file and upload it. It sounds boring (tedious), but still, a good thing to do.

Swap The Old Antenna With A New Antenna

If your existing WiFi router uses an internal antenna, then adding an external one would be a good option. It will lead to a stronger WiFi signal ever.

In case, your router has come with antennas then you can add on yourself, but if not or if you have throw them away a long time before, then you have to add it by yourself to have the best performance of your WiFi network.

If you have an antenna with you and it is not giving a better performance, then we would suggest to get rid of the older one and go with a brand new antenna.

Despite the fact, you can choose between omni-directional antennas that spread the internet signals in every direction, or directional ones that give a signal only in a specific direction.

Go With A Netgear Wireless Range Extender

'Distance' is one of the major problems. If your WiFi network has to cover a larger area than a router alone is not capable of sending internet signals to the far corners.

Only a WiFi range extender can give a new life to the dead zones.

To set it up, you just require to follow some easy steps given below.

  • Place the Netgear wireless range extender in reach of your existing, up-to-date WiFi router.

Keep a set of Ethernet cable handy with you:

  • The first one is to connect router with the range extender.

  • And the second one would be required to connect your Netgear extender with your WiFi-enabled device like computer or a laptop.

Once you have connected your smart devices physically and properly with each other, pull up a web browser. Go to its address bar, not the search bar - type mywifiext.net and hit Enter.

Now, you just have to follow the on-screen instructions provided by Netgear Genie home page and set up your Netgear wireless range extender.
